   1// SPDX-License-Identifier: GPL-2.0-or-later
   2/*
   3 * IP6 tables REJECT target module
   4 * Linux INET6 implementation
   5 *
   6 * Copyright (C)2003 USAGI/WIDE Project
   7 *
   8 * Authors:
   9 *      Yasuyuki Kozakai        <yasuyuki.kozakai@toshiba.co.jp>
  10 *
  11 * Copyright (c) 2005-2007 Patrick McHardy <kaber@trash.net>
  12 *
  13 * Based on net/ipv4/netfilter/ipt_REJECT.c
  14 */
  15#define pr_fmt(fmt) KBUILD_MODNAME ": " fmt
  16
  17#include <linux/gfp.h>
  18#include <linux/module.h>
  19#include <linux/skbuff.h>
  20#include <linux/icmpv6.h>
  21#include <linux/netdevice.h>
  22#include <net/icmp.h>
  23#include <net/flow.h>
  24#include <linux/netfilter/x_tables.h>
  25#include <linux/netfilter_ipv6/ip6_tables.h>
  26#include <linux/netfilter_ipv6/ip6t_REJECT.h>
  27
  28#include <net/netfilter/ipv6/nf_reject.h>
  29
  30MODULE_AUTHOR("Yasuyuki KOZAKAI <yasuyuki.kozakai@toshiba.co.jp>");
  31MODULE_DESCRIPTION("Xtables: packet \"rejection\" target for IPv6");
  32MODULE_LICENSE("GPL");
  33
  34static unsigned int
  35reject_tg6(struct sk_buff *skb, const struct xt_action_param *par)
  36{
  37        const struct ip6t_reject_info *reject = par->targinfo;
  38        struct net *net = xt_net(par);
  39
  40        switch (reject->with) {
  41        case IP6T_ICMP6_NO_ROUTE:
  42                nf_send_unreach6(net, skb, ICMPV6_NOROUTE, xt_hooknum(par));
  43                break;
  44        case IP6T_ICMP6_ADM_PROHIBITED:
  45                nf_send_unreach6(net, skb, ICMPV6_ADM_PROHIBITED,
  46                                 xt_hooknum(par));
  47                break;
  48        case IP6T_ICMP6_NOT_NEIGHBOUR:
  49                nf_send_unreach6(net, skb, ICMPV6_NOT_NEIGHBOUR,
  50                                 xt_hooknum(par));
  51                break;
  52        case IP6T_ICMP6_ADDR_UNREACH:
  53                nf_send_unreach6(net, skb, ICMPV6_ADDR_UNREACH,
  54                                 xt_hooknum(par));
  55                break;
  56        case IP6T_ICMP6_PORT_UNREACH:
  57                nf_send_unreach6(net, skb, ICMPV6_PORT_UNREACH,
  58                                 xt_hooknum(par));
  59                break;
  60        case IP6T_ICMP6_ECHOREPLY:
  61                /* Do nothing */
  62                break;
  63        case IP6T_TCP_RESET:
  64                nf_send_reset6(net, par->state->sk, skb, xt_hooknum(par));
  65                break;
  66        case IP6T_ICMP6_POLICY_FAIL:
  67                nf_send_unreach6(net, skb, ICMPV6_POLICY_FAIL, xt_hooknum(par));
  68                break;
  69        case IP6T_ICMP6_REJECT_ROUTE:
  70                nf_send_unreach6(net, skb, ICMPV6_REJECT_ROUTE,
  71                                 xt_hooknum(par));
  72                break;
  73        }
  74
  75        return NF_DROP;
  76}
  77
  78static int reject_tg6_check(const struct xt_tgchk_param *par)
  79{
  80        const struct ip6t_reject_info *rejinfo = par->targinfo;
  81        const struct ip6t_entry *e = par->entryinfo;
  82
  83        if (rejinfo->with == IP6T_ICMP6_ECHOREPLY) {
  84                pr_info_ratelimited("ECHOREPLY is not supported\n");
  85                return -EINVAL;
  86        } else if (rejinfo->with == IP6T_TCP_RESET) {
  87                /* Must specify that it's a TCP packet */
  88                if (!(e->ipv6.flags & IP6T_F_PROTO) ||
  89                    e->ipv6.proto != IPPROTO_TCP ||
  90                    (e->ipv6.invflags & XT_INV_PROTO)) {
  91                        pr_info_ratelimited("TCP_RESET illegal for non-tcp\n");
  92                        return -EINVAL;
  93                }
  94        }
  95        return 0;
  96}
  97
  98static struct xt_target reject_tg6_reg __read_mostly = {
  99        .name           = "REJECT",
 100        .family         = NFPROTO_IPV6,
 101        .target         = reject_tg6,
 102        .targetsize     = sizeof(struct ip6t_reject_info),
 103        .table          = "filter",
 104        .hooks          = (1 << NF_INET_LOCAL_IN) | (1 << NF_INET_FORWARD) |
 105                          (1 << NF_INET_LOCAL_OUT),
 106        .checkentry     = reject_tg6_check,
 107        .me             = THIS_MODULE
 108};
 109
 110static int __init reject_tg6_init(void)
 111{
 112        return xt_register_target(&reject_tg6_reg);
 113}
 114
 115static void __exit reject_tg6_exit(void)
 116{
 117        xt_unregister_target(&reject_tg6_reg);
 118}
 119
 120module_init(reject_tg6_init);
 121module_exit(reject_tg6_exit);
